About Nicolas Lebas

Nicolas Lebas is a scholar working on Global and Planetary Change, Atmospheric Science, Oceanography, Ecology and Geochemistry and Petrology, having authored 5 papers that have together received 386 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Climate variability and models (3 papers), Oceanographic and Atmospheric Processes (2 papers), Karst Systems and Hydrogeology (1 paper),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(1 paper), Groundwater and Isotope Geochemistry (1 paper), Marine and fisheries research (1 paper),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(1 paper) and Atmospheric Ozone and Climate (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Atmospheric Science (344 citations), Global and Planetary Change (291 citations), Oceanography (51 citations), Paleontology (17 citations) and Geophysics (21 citations). Nicolas Lebas has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Myriam Khodri, Markus Stoffel, Virginie Poulain, Clive Oppenheimer, Sébastien Guillet, Joël Guiot, Valérie Masson‐Delmotte, Slimane Bekki, Martin Beniston and Christophe Corona.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Climate, Nature Communications, Geochemistry Geophysics Geosystems and Nature Geoscience.
